Mars in the sixth house
The sixth house is where Mars rejoices, the ancient authors placing it here for its usefulness. Work, service, routine, illness and the daily grind of maintenance all suit a planet that likes something concrete to push against. Capacity for sustained labour is high, and unpleasant jobs tend to land with this person because they will actually do them. Health tends to run hot: fevers, inflammations, injuries that heal fast. Conflict with colleagues or employees is a recurring theme rather than a catastrophe. Because the energy is real but finite, the discipline this placement teaches is rest taken before exhaustion insists on it.
Mars rejoices in the sixth house. It is the one house the tradition says this planet is at ease in whatever sign it holds.

Which sign holds it
Under whole-sign houses the rising sign settles every other house at once. If you know your Ascendant, this is the sign your sixth house holds and the planet that rules it.
| Aries rising | Virgo · ruled by Mercury |
|---|---|
| Taurus rising | Libra · ruled by Venus |
| Gemini rising | Scorpio · ruled by Mars |
| Cancer rising | Sagittarius · ruled by Jupiter |
| Leo rising | Capricorn · ruled by Saturn |
| Virgo rising | Aquarius · ruled by Saturn |
| Libra rising | Pisces · ruled by Jupiter |
| Scorpio rising | Aries · ruled by Mars |
| Sagittarius rising | Taurus · ruled by Venus |
| Capricorn rising | Gemini · ruled by Mercury |
| Aquarius rising | Cancer · ruled by Moon |
| Pisces rising | Leo · ruled by Sun |
Quadrant systems such as Placidus cut the houses by the angles instead, so a planet near a cusp can land in a different house from the whole-sign answer. The chart page shows both.
